WebNov 3, 2024 · No set amount of crystal meth will lead to an overdose. However, it is essential to remember that the drug is potent, and even a small amount can be dangerous. The risk of overdosing increases when someone takes multiple doses in a short period or if they have a high tolerance for the drug.
